Facilities Ticket — Cleaning Crew Access, Brindle Annex

For new starters handling evening lock-up: the Sorano Cleaning crew arrives nightly at 21:30 via the annex side door. Check their rota sheet, note arrival in the log, and ensure the storeroom is relocked afterward. To let them through the side door, enter the access code below.

badge for yaweg-hafog: bdg-GX-6

### Welcome to the Flourhouse Ops Team!

Quick heads-up on our quirkiest rule: the bakery order cutoff. Orders placed after 14:00 local time roll to the next business day, no exceptions — the Crumbline scheduler enforces this automatically, so don't try to sneak one in manually. You'll mostly touch this when deploying cutoff-config changes to the order service. Those deploys go through our signed-release pipeline, and your first task is setting up deploy access. You'll need to register the deploy key below with the pipeline.

rollout seal: bky4_DFM9

Heads up, new folks: the Strongbay secrets vault sealed itself again overnight. Best guess is the load balancer's health checks were hammering the `/sys/health` endpoint during the failover drill, and the vault interpreted the flapping as tampering. This happens maybe twice a quarter, so don't stress. To unseal, you'll need quorum — grab anyone from the Corridor team plus one platform lead. Once you've got both people on the call, have them enter the recovery passphrase, which is recorded below for this rotation.

unlock words, tawif-tahop: oliys-ulawyn-tamdor-lamys-casox-jormir-fraius-kasath-ulador-ulamir-holir-sorys-holeth

Handover — cron migration to Weftline

Moved 14 of 22 cron jobs to the Weftline workflow engine. Remaining eight are billing-adjacent; leave them until Marli signs off. If a Weftline worker stalls overnight, restart via the admin shell, not systemd. The shell prompts for the recovery passphrase, which follows below.

unlock words, bahop-fawef: novmir-druwyn-soriel-rusdor-kasion